#5d7054 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d7054 is composed of 36.5% red, 43.9%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 0% magenta, 25%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 100.7 degrees, a saturation of 14.3% and a lightness of 38.4%. #5d7054 color hex could be obtained by blending #bae0a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#5d7054 color description : Very dark grayish green.
#5d7054 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d7054 has RGB values of R:93, G:112,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 6123604.
